WebDescribe the steps which led to the origin of life (organic molecules form, macromolecules polymerize, a hereditary mechanism develops, membrane-enclosed protocells form). Apply the principles of evolution by natural selection to pre-biotic scenarios. The origin of life is a mystery, the ultimate chicken-and-egg conundrum ( R Service, 2015 ).

NASA defines life as "a self-sustaining chemical system capable of Darwinian [i.e., biological] evolution."
